Output eb3061d6000041f381db4ff97793cde59b88d0882ce8184a232942875c1b9cd4:1

value
18129463
script pubkey
OP_0 OP_PUSHBYTES_20 e75861b52ba6d49209fc61e6886a807afa32c8d1
address
bc1quavxrdft5m2fyz0uv8ngs65q0tar9jx372fcrs
transaction
eb3061d6000041f381db4ff97793cde59b88d0882ce8184a232942875c1b9cd4
confirmations
217049
spent
true